This case study details the business challenge faced by Mid-Wisconsin Bank, which operates approximately 19 servers in its main office and additional servers in 13 retail locations across Wisconsin. The bank was using Symantec Backup Exec for backups but found the restoration process to be cumbersome and time-consuming. To address these issues, the bank evaluated several solutions, including Exagrid, LiveVault, D2D, and Quorum. Ultimately, the bank selected the onQ Site Recovery Appliance from Quorum due to its capability for instant recovery of critical data and applications, as well as its ease of use. The case study outlines the significant business benefits realized by the bank, including a reduction in data recovery time from over a week to less than one hour, the ability to conduct monthly testing of systems, and improved file-level restore times. The bank also plans to expand the use of onQ to protect its phone system in the future.
